This tutorial shows how to generate a VxWorks 6.3 Board Support Package (BSP) within EDK for the dual independent processing system (BSB1 + BSB2) PPC440 hardware build. The tutorial also provides instructions on how to create VxWorks system images for each processing system using Wind River’s Workbench 2.5 environment.
ML510 Dual PPC440 VxWorks Project Creation (PDF)The pre-built bitstream, ACE file, VxWorks BSP and Workbench project and executable VxWorks ELF file are provided below. The overlay zip file is provided as a convenience for users running through the tutorial to re-create the pre-built result files.
